Transaction 137931d71f39c4d5eb16c0c8104d42dff34dbde343d57557142f8eae40456c1a

1 Input
2 Outputs
  • 137931d71f39c4d5eb16c0c8104d42dff34dbde343d57557142f8eae40456c1a:0
  • value  166182967
    address  3JHqRX7Q9ZYgeQKM77Z4izJ8TaeuLT7yMc
  • 137931d71f39c4d5eb16c0c8104d42dff34dbde343d57557142f8eae40456c1a:1
  • value  235542
    address  35GfZdVRZGd2Z976UYLCAJtm7DZmxET8V2